Paul Warren Design
This was previously a small basement shower which was rarely used. The client wanted a smart cloakroom where their guests could use when they entertaining. The rear was initially tanked due to damp issues then. Mirrors were used to give the illusion of more space and to bounce light around what is a dark space.
